Keeping Your Entlebucher Mountain Dog Physically Fit: Activities You Can Do Together

Introduction

Entlebucher Mountain Dogs are energetic and intelligent canines known for their strong build and playful nature. As an active breed, they require a variety of activities to stay physically fit and mentally stimulated. It is essential to incorporate diverse forms of exercise into their routine to meet their needs. This article outlines suitable activities to help you maintain the fitness and health of your Entlebucher Mountain Dog.

Details

  • Daily Walks

    • Aim for at least two walks a day, each lasting between 30 to 60 minutes.
    • Vary the routes to keep the walks interesting for your dog.
    • Provide opportunities for your dog to explore new environments, such as parks or nature trails.
  • Hiking Adventures

    • Find dog-friendly hiking trails where your dog can experience a variety of terrains and scents.
    • Ensure the trails are safe and have appropriate difficulty levels based on your dog’s fitness.
    • Bring plenty of water and snacks for both you and your dog, especially for longer hikes.
  • Agility Training

    • Set up a simple agility course in your backyard or during visits to local parks.
      • Incorporate jumps, tunnels, and weave poles to enhance their coordination.
      • Gradually increase the complexity of the course as your dog becomes more adept.
    • Join an agility club or sign up for classes to learn from professionals and meet other dog lovers.
  • Interactive Playtime

    • Engage in games such as fetch, tug-of-war, or frisbee to promote physical exertion.
      • Use durable toys designed for strong chewers to keep playtime safe and enjoyable.
      • Vary the playing fields by using open spaces, backyards, or beaches for different experiences.
    • Teach your dog tricks during playtime to stimulate mental engagement along with physical activity.
  • Swimming Sessions

    • Find local dog-friendly pools or water bodies where your dog can swim under supervision.
      • Perfect for joint-friendly exercise, swimming allows for a good workout without harsh impact.
      • Monitor your dog closely to ensure safety, especially if they are not accustomed to water.
    • Introduce floating toys to encourage your dog to swim and retrieve items.
  • Canine Sports

    • Explore organized canine sports like flyball, dock diving, or herding activities suitable for their breed.
      • These organized sports not only provide physical exercise but also encourage teamwork and bonding.
      • Research local clubs or teams to find out where to participate.
  • Socialization Opportunities

    • Arrange playdates with other dogs to enhance social skills and engage in fun, vigorous play.
      • Look for local dog parks where your Entlebucher can run freely and interact with different breeds.
      • Ensure the other dogs are well-socialized and healthy to keep the experience positive.
  • Mental Stimulation Activities

    • Utilize puzzle toys and treat-dispensing games to provide mental exercise that complements physical activity.
      • Rotate different toys to keep your dog engaged and stave off boredom.
      • Consider incorporating scent work or tracking activities by hiding treats around the house or garden.
